At least 33 Iraqis were killed and scores wounded on Thursday as a wave of bomb attacks hit the capital Baghdad, police sources said.
The bombs targeted markets and commercial streets. The government put the death toll far lower, saying only three people were killed and 44 wounded in the violence.
